Winham Street Christian Academy (Closed 2004)

Winham Street Christian Academy in Salinas, CA serves 28 co–ed students in grades 3 through 11 within a central city community.
The school has a student–teacher ratio of 9:1 with three teaching staff members providing regular elementary and secondary education.
Affiliated with Accelerated Christian Education (ACE) and the Association of Christian Schools International (ACSI), the academy maintains a Christian orientation with other religious affiliation.
Approximately 67% of the student body identifies as students of color, reflecting some diversity in this California private school.
As a small school in Salinas, it offers a lower enrollment size compared to nearby schools, supporting a close–knit educational environment.
